The Shift Toward Convenience: Pet Owners' Changing Behavior

The pandemic brought a surge in pet adoptions, with more households welcoming furry companions than ever before. Even as life returned to normal, one thing stayed the same, pets became central to daily routines.
Spending more time at home has led pet owners to prioritize convenience and quality when it comes to their pets’ needs. From nutritious food to medications, quick and reliable access to supplies is no longer optional. Local delivery bridges the gap, ensuring pet owners can care for their animals without disruptions, keeping tails wagging and customers coming back.
Advantages of Local Delivery for Pet Shops
- Improved Customer Retention
Pet owners rely on regular supplies like food and medications, and local delivery makes these recurring needs hassle-free. By offering consistent, dependable service, pet shops can build trust and loyalty, keeping customers coming back for more. - Access to Niche Markets
Local delivery opens doors to serving specific customer groups, like those needing specialty diets, eco-friendly products, or unique pet care items. This personalized approach helps smaller shops cater to diverse needs that big-box retailers often overlook. - Reduced Competition with Larger Retailers
Quick, local delivery allows pet shops to compete effectively with online giants. By focusing on speed and proximity, local businesses can provide a personal touch that e-commerce platforms can’t replicate, giving them an edge in their community.
Key Trends in Local Delivery for Pet Shops in 2025
- Omnichannel Growth
Pet shops are blending in-store and online shopping experiences to offer customers more flexibility. Subscription services for recurring needs, like food or treats, are also gaining traction, providing convenience for busy pet owners. - Same-Day Delivery Expectations
Customers want their orders fast, especially for essentials like pet food and medications. Many pet shops are teaming up with third-party services to meet this growing demand for same-day delivery. - Personalization and Customization
Tailored options, like breed-specific diets or personalized meal kits, are becoming a hit with pet owners. Local delivery services that offer these customized products can build stronger connections with their customers and stand out in the market.
Challenges and Solutions for Implementing Local Delivery
- Inventory Management
Managing a variety of products like food, medications, and accessories can be tricky, especially with seasonal demand spikes for items like flea treatments or holiday pet outfits. Accurate forecasting and proactive stock management help ensure shelves stay stocked without overloading storage space. - Logistics and Fulfillment
Efficient delivery is all about balancing costs and speed.
